Wood Floor Replacement in Austin, TX
Wood floor replacement services involve removing existing flooring and installing new wood surfaces to enhance the appearance and functionality of a home. This service covers a variety of projects, including complete floor overhauls, replacing damaged or outdated wood floors, and upgrading to different wood styles or finishes. Homeowners typically seek this service when their current flooring shows signs of extensive wear, water damage, or when a renovation calls for a fresh, updated look that complements their interior design.
Before requesting wood floor replacement, property owners usually want to understand the types of wood available, the durability of different finishes, and the scope of the project. It's important to consider the condition of the subfloor, the compatibility of new materials with existing structures, and any potential disruptions during installation. Clarifying these details can help ensure the new flooring meets aesthetic preferences, performance needs, and budget expectations.

Wood Floor Replacement Questions
What types of wood floors can be replaced? Various wood flooring materials such as oak, maple, and hickory can be replaced to match existing styles or update the look of a space.
When should a wood floor be replaced instead of repaired? Replacement is recommended when the flooring has extensive damage, deep warping, or severe wear that cannot be effectively restored through repairs.
What are common reasons for replacing wood floors? Common reasons include water damage, pet stains, deep scratches, or outdated styles that no longer suit the property’s aesthetic.
What should property owners consider before replacing wood flooring? Consider the existing subfloor condition, desired flooring style, and how the new floor will complement the space's overall design.
